Understanding Erectile Dysfunction

Before diving into the impact of lifestyle changes, it is essential to understand what erectile dysfunction is. ED is defined as the inability to attain or maintain an erection sufficient for satisfactory sexual performance. Causes can range from psychological factors such as anxiety and depression to physical issues including cardiovascular diseases, diabetes, and hormonal imbalances.

Often, healthcare providers recommend various ED treatments, including oral phosphodiesterase type 5 (PDE5) inhibitors like Viagra and Cialis, injections, vacuum devices, and even surgical options. However, patients may find that implementing lifestyle changes can significantly complement these treatments, leading to better outcomes.

The Role of Lifestyle in ED

1. Diet and Nutrition

A healthy diet is fundamental in managing erectile dysfunction. Studies show that a diet low in fat, sugar, and processed foods combined with high intake of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ins can improve overall health and directly impact erectile function. The Mediterranean diet, for example, is rich in healthy fats, antioxidants, and fibers, all of which have been linked to enhanced libido and erectile function.

ED treatments may prove more effective when patients are consuming nutrient-rich foods that promote good blood flow and reduce inflammation. Foods rich in vitamins, especially Vitamin E, Vitamin D, and Zinc, support testosterone production and overall sexual health.

2. Physical Activity

Regular physical activity is another critical lifestyle change that can significantly enhance the effectiveness of ED treatments. Exercise boosts cardiovascular health, improves blood circulation, and helps manage weight—all vital components of sexual health.

Incorporating both aerobic exercises and strength training can help reduce the severity of erectile dysfunction. For men who are overweight or obese, losing even a small percentage of body weight can lead to substantial improvements in erectile function. When combined with ED treatments, these lifestyle changes increase the likelihood of achieving and maintaining erections.

3. Sleep Quality

Poor sleep quality is linked to various health issues, including erectile dysfunction. Sleep disorders, particularly obstructive sleep apnea, can negatively impact hormone levels and lead to decreased libido. Making lifestyle changes to improve sleep hygiene—such as establishing a regular sleep schedule, creating a comfortable sleep environment, and minimizing screen time before bed—can have a positive effect on ED.

Getting adequate sleep supports hormonal balance, which is crucial for sexual health. When men focus on improving their sleep patterns, they may find that their ED treatments are more effective, as the body can function optimally.

4. Stress Management and Mental Health

Psychological factors, including stress, anxiety, and depression, can significantly influence erectile function. Stress management techniques such as meditation, yoga, or even simple breathing exercises can help mitigate anxiety and promote a healthy mindset.

Men who prioritize their mental health often report improved efficacy of ED treatments. Therapy and counseling can also provide support in dealing with the psychological aspects of erectile dysfunction, further enhancing the outcomes of medical interventions.

Additional Factors Influencing ED Treatments

1. Avoiding Substance Abuse

Substance abuse, particularly tobacco and excessive alcohol consumption, can severely impair erectile function. Smoking is known to damage blood vessels and impede blood flow, which are critical for achieving an erection. Limiting alcohol intake can also improve sexual performance and increase the effectiveness of ED treatments.

2. Regular Check-ups and Monitoring

Regular health check-ups are essential for men dealing with erectile dysfunction. Monitoring underlying conditions, such as diabetes or hypertension, can help tailor ED treatments more effectively. Engaging with healthcare providers about lifestyle changes can provide additional support and resources.
